   /**
    * Start the activation
    * 
    * @throws ResourceException for any error
    */
   public void start() throws ResourceException
   {
      deliveryActive = new SynchronizedBoolean(true);
      ra.getWorkManager().scheduleWork(new SetupActivation());
   }

   /**
    * Stop the activation
    */
   public void stop()
   {
      deliveryActive.set(false);
      teardown();
   }

   /**
    * Handles any failure by trying to reconnect
    */
   public void handleFailure(Throwable failure)
   {
      log.warn("Failure in jms activation " + spec, failure);
      
      while (deliveryActive.get())
      {
         teardown();
         try
         {
            Thread.sleep(spec.getReconnectIntervalLong());
         }
         catch (InterruptedException e)
         {
            log.debug("Interrupted trying to reconnect " + spec, e);
            break;
         }

         log.info("Attempting to reconnect " + spec);
         try
         {
            setup();
            log.info("Reconnected with messaging provider.");            
            break;
         }
         catch (Throwable t)
         {
            log.error("Unable to reconnect " + spec, t);
         }
         

      }
   }

   /**
    * Setup the activation
    * 
    * @throws Exception for any error
    */
   protected void setup() throws Exception
   {
      log.debug("Setting up " + spec);

      setupJMSProviderAdapter();
      Context ctx = adapter.getInitialContext();
      log.debug("Using context " + ctx.getEnvironment() + " for " + spec);
      try
      {
         setupDLQ(ctx);
         setupDestination(ctx);
         setupConnection(ctx);
      }
      finally
      {
         ctx.close();
      }
      setupSessionPool();
      
      log.debug("Setup complete " + this);
   }
   
   /**
    * Teardown the activation
    */
   protected void teardown()
   {
      log.debug("Tearing down " + spec);

      teardownSessionPool();
      teardownConnection();
      teardownDestination();
      teardownDLQ();

      log.debug("Tearing down complete " + this);
   }

   /**
    * Setup the Connection
    *
    * @param ctx the naming context
    * @throws Exception for any error
    */
   protected void setupConnection(Context ctx) throws Exception
   {
      log.debug("setup connection " + this);

      String user = spec.getUser();
      String pass = spec.getPassword();
      String clientID = spec.getClientId();
      if (spec.isTopic())
         connection = setupTopicConnection(ctx, user, pass, clientID);
      else
         connection = setupQueueConnection(ctx, user, pass, clientID);
      
      log.debug("established connection " + this);
   }
   
   /**
    * Setup a Queue Connection
    *
    * @param ctx the naming context
    * @param user the user
    * @param pass the password
    * @param clientID the client id
    * @throws Exception for any error
    */
   protected QueueConnection setupQueueConnection(Context ctx, String user, String pass, String clientID) throws Exception
   {
      String queueFactoryRef = adapter.getQueueFactoryRef();
      log.debug("Attempting to lookup queue connection factory " + queueFactoryRef);
      QueueConnectionFactory qcf = (QueueConnectionFactory) Util.lookup(ctx, queueFactoryRef, QueueConnectionFactory.class);
      log.debug("Got queue connection factory " + qcf + " from " + queueFactoryRef);
      log.debug("Attempting to create queue connection with user " + user);
      QueueConnection result;
      if (qcf instanceof XAQueueConnectionFactory && isDeliveryTransacted)
      {
         XAQueueConnectionFactory xaqcf = (XAQueueConnectionFactory) qcf;
         if (user != null)
            result = xaqcf.createXAQueueConnection(user, pass);
         else
            result = xaqcf.createXAQueueConnection();
      }
      else
      {
         if (user != null)
            result = qcf.createQueueConnection(user, pass);
         else
            result = qcf.createQueueConnection();
      }
      if (clientID != null)
         result.setClientID(clientID);
      result.setExceptionListener(this);
      log.debug("Using queue connection " + result);
      return result;
   }
